
The African Women Lawyers Association, AWLA, Rivers State Branch has commended the President of the Nigerian Bar Association, Mr Paul Usoro SAN, for facilitating the appointment of its members as life bencers, and into other crucial positions in the polity.
The statement signed by Mrs Cordelia Eke,
Coordinator of AWLA, Rivers State chapter lauded Mr Usoro for “living up to his gender empowerment promise and nominating three top female Lawyers recently appointed to the Body of Benchers.”
Body of Benchers
- Prof Joy Ezeilo;
- Lady Gloria Umoren;
- Olufunmi Oluyede The women Lawyer’s body also commended Mr. Paul Usoro for the following appointments:
- Mrs. Efe Etomi into the National Judicial Council (NJC)
- Hajiya Safiya Balarabe as a member of the National Electricity Regulatory Commission (NERC)
- Aisha Mohammed as Member of the Presidential Committee on Drug Addiction
- Iyabode Ogunseye as a member of the Presidential Committee on the Reform of SARS,
among several other appointments.
“Their appointment as Members of the Body of Benchers and committee members, we believe, will add immense value to the distinguished body”. The statement said.
